After being delayed indefinitely earlier in the year, Lego Star Wars: The Skywalker Saga has received a Spring 2022 release window along with a brand new trailer.
Geoff Keighley debuted the new trailer and release window for The Skywalker Saga during the Live Gamescom Opening Ceremony. The trailer showed off some new footage from the game, and also revealed that it's coming early next year.
In addition to opening a new release window for the game, we've also taken a fresh look at gameplay. The trailer showcased several third-person lightsaber and blaster duels, as well as a large map of the Galaxy and open world areas to explore. Fans will also note that this confirms that the game will feature voiced characters and not Lego grunts.
While you might think that Skywalker Saga is a repackaging of Lego Star Wars: The Complete Saga and Lego Star Wars: The Force Awakens with some new content based on later films, it's actually a brand new game with completely different levels, cat -scenes. and features from other games.
As you can guess from the title, Lego Star Wars: The Skywalker Saga covers every Star Wars episode from the prequel trilogy to the sequel trilogy. It also contains levels based on The Mandalorian, although it was previously confirmed that it would not feature content from Star Wars: Rogue One or Solo: A Star Wars Story.
